Amino-PEG10-Boc BiologicalActivity
| Description | Amino-PEG10-Boc is a PEG-based PROTAC linker that can be used in the synthesis of PROTACs[1]. |

| In Vitro | PROTACs contain two different ligands connected by a linker; one is a ligand for an E3 ubiquitin ligase and the other is for the target protein. PROTACs exploit the intracellular ubiquitin-proteasome system to selectively degrade target proteins[1]. |
